I'm fitting an extractor fan but struggling with the wiring layout in the room, the lighting supply comes from a junction box in the next room (outbuilding conversion) i can get a supply to the fan location, but i'm struggling with the switched live (timer fan) i can't get access to the switch wire, which runs from pullcord to ceiling fitting, is there any way around this, the supply to the ceiling lght fitting also comes from the junction box in the next room, so i can access both supplies but not the switch wire, Don't know if i've explained this clearly
 
Sponsored Links
Can you not take fan cable from light fitting?? Flat roof??
 
Thanks for your reply Lectrician No its not a flat roof, its vaulted type ceiling plasterboarded with 100mm insulation, no chance of feeding cable through, beam in cetre line of room, can i complete the lighting circuit via the switched live on the fan (if that makes sense) supply ______switch______lamp_______fan s/l will this work ? is it allowed ? would mean the lamp and fan would both be on the isolator switch
